Guidelines

  • Reserve your timed-entry tickets online in advance to secure your preferred entry window at Mont Saint-Michel Abbey and bypass the main ticket lines.
  • Present your digital voucher on your smartphone at the dedicated fast-track entrance for immediate scanning.
  • Pass through mandatory security screening at the entrance, ensuring you leave large luggage, backpacks over 40 cm, and sharp objects at the mainland visitor centre.
  • Adhere to modest dress standards inside the abbey church of Mont Saint-Michel Abbey, keeping shoulders and knees covered, and wear comfortable footwear for climbing stone staircases.

Tips

  • Pre-book fast-track timed-entry tickets online to bypass the main ticket queues directly at Mont Saint-Michel Abbey.
  • Arrive before 10 AM or after 5 PM when tour buses depart to explore the ramparts and Mont Saint-Michel Abbey without heavy foot traffic.
  • Schedule your visit on Tuesdays or Thursdays to avoid peak crowds, as Wednesdays and weekends see higher visitor volumes.
  • Consider staying overnight on the island to experience the village and monument during the quiet late evening and early morning hours.

Get There

Le Mont-Saint-Michel

France

GPS:48.63610, -1.51150

  • Regional Train Connections: Board the direct train from Paris Montparnasse or local connections via Rennes Station and Caen Station to reach Pontorson Station, the closest rail hub to the site.
  • Direct Shuttle Bus: Transfer at Pontorson Station onto the dedicated shuttle bus, which drops visitors just steps from the causeway lead-in to maximize time for exploring Mont Saint-Michel Abbey.
  • Free Site Shuttle: Board the free shuttle bus named Le Passeur right near the main mainland parking area and tourist center for a quick 12-minute ride to the drop-off point near the village entrance.
  • Pedestrian Causeway Walk: Enjoy a scenic 40-to-50-minute walk across the central pedestrian path from the mainland parking zone directly to the entrance below Mont Saint-Michel Abbey.

What To Eat

  • Omelette de la Mère Poulard: Prepared in Le Mont-Saint-Michel, this historic wood-fired soufflé omelette is famous for its airy texture and rich Norman butter.
  • Agneau de Pré-Salé: Raised on the salt marshes surrounding Le Mont-Saint-Michel, this salt-meadow lamb offers a uniquely tender and naturally seasoned flavor.
  • Bouchot Mussels: Cultivated in the tidal bay of Le Mont-Saint-Michel, these PDO-certified mussels are traditionally steamed with white wine, herbs, and cream.
  • Galettes and Normandy Cider: Savory buckwheat crepes paired with local crisp cider are enjoyed throughout the historic streets of Le Mont-Saint-Michel.

Where To Stay

  • Intramuros Village: Base yourself directly on the island within Le Mont-Saint-Michel to experience the historic medieval village steps away from the iconic Mont Saint-Michel Abbey.
  • La Caserne: Situated on the immediate mainland entry point of Le Mont-Saint-Michel, this hotel district offers modern amenities and convenient access to the causeway path.
  • Beauvoir Area: Located just south along the Couesnon River, this quiet neighborhood provides scenic views of the bay and straightforward access to the shuttle stops heading toward Le Mont-Saint-Michel.
  • Pontorson District: Situated a short distance inland from Le Mont-Saint-Michel, this charming riverside town features traditional Norman dining and convenient transport links to Mont Saint-Michel Abbey.
